Hypnosis
A trance-like state characterized by heightened focus, concentration, and suggestibility, often used for therapeutic purposes.
Withdrawal Illness
Symptoms that occur after abrupt discontinuation or decrease in intake of substances that have been used regularly.
Physical Dependence
A physiological state in which the body becomes accustomed to the presence of a substance, leading to withdrawal symptoms when the substance is reduced or stopped.
Inhibitions
Psychological mechanisms that hold back or restrain one's behaviors, emotions, or thoughts, often unconsciously.
